Madeleine Tepe Misleh is sharing a final, tender memory of her older brother, dentist Spencer Tepe, days before he and his wife, Monique Tepe, were found slain in their Columbus, Ohio, home on Dec. 30.

Nearly three weeks after the couple's deaths, Misleh — 35, two years younger than Spencer — spoke with PEOPLE about the last evening she spent with them: a full-circle family moment of video games and laughter.

"My brother has always been one of my biggest fans," Misleh says. "One of the biggest fans of my art, so he was always proud."

Misleh recalls that on Christmas Day she gifted princess dresses she had made for Spencer and Monique's 3-year-old daughter, Emilia. That night the family gathered to play Mario Kart: "We grew up playing Nintendo 64, and we were playing Mario Kart, and Spencer and Monique got a Nintendo Switch for Christmas. So the last night I was with them, we were all playing Mario Kart. It was a full circle moment," she said.

She remembers a lighter exchange from the visit: "We gave them controllers and Spencer and Monique gave us electric toothbrushes," she laughs.

Investigation and Arrest

Columbus police discovered Spencer, 37, and Monique, 39, dead at their home on Dec. 30. Their two children, ages 3 and 1, were found in a nearby room and were physically unharmed. Authorities have described the killings as "domestic-violence related" and "targeted," though they have not released a public motive.

On Jan. 10, police arrested 39-year-old Michael David McKee, who had been briefly married to Monique more than a decade ago. McKee was arrested near his workplace in Rockford, Illinois, and was booked into the Winnebago County Sheriff’s Office. He has been indicted on aggravated murder and burglary charges and is expected to be extradited to Ohio to face prosecution. Prior to his indictment he told an Illinois judge, through a public defender, that he intends to plead not guilty.

Remembering Spencer

Misleh describes Spencer as a supportive brother and proud father who loved his family. She also served as his practice patient during his dental training: "I was Spencer’s practice patient for Invisalign, so I was always going up to Columbus while he was in dental school," she says with a laugh.

Beyond his career as a dentist, Spencer was active in his community. He spent roughly a decade mentoring a child from first grade through high school; that mentee even attended Spencer’s dental school graduation in 2017. "Spencer was always involved, he was always in a club. Always pushing the limits — everywhere," Misleh says.

Friends and relatives say the couple were "madly in love," and the slayings have left the community stunned and searching for answers.
